Originally Posted by Mary2e
Considering taking Amtrak from NJ to LA. Anyone else do it in first class?
Yes. a number of times. You will need to change trains most likely in Chicago, but New Orleans is also a possibility. I happen to enjoy trains and traveling by sleeping car (first class) so I have enjoyed my trips on Amtrak for the most part. However, in the past couple of years there have been a number of operational issues (covid for one) and the elimination of full dining car service on East Coast trains that have made the trip less attractive and usually more expensive. But even if Amtrak was perfection, some people might not enjoy the experience that much (for any of a hundred reasons),
